ADU Contractors in SeaTac, WA: Building Near One of the Nation's Busiest Airports
SeaTac, Washington is a unique city shaped largely by its proximity to Seattle-Tacoma International Airport. This means that ADU contractors working in SeaTac must navigate not only standard King County and city zoning regulations, but also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) height restrictions and noise compatibility guidelines. These aviation-related constraints can directly impact the design and construction of Accessory Dwelling Units, making it essential to hire an experienced ADU contractor who understands the local landscape.
SeaTac Zoning and ADU Regulations
SeaTac operates under its own municipal code, separate from unincorporated King County. Homeowners looking to build an ADU in SeaTac must comply with the SeaTac Municipal Code Title 15, which governs land use and zoning. Key considerations include:
- ADUs are generally permitted in single-family residential zones (RS zones)
- Both attached ADUs and detached ADUs (DADUs) may be allowed depending on lot size and zoning designation
- Setback requirements typically require structures to maintain specific distances from property lines
- Height limits may be further restricted in FAA-designated airspace zones around the airport
- Owner-occupancy requirements may apply, though Washington State has been progressively relaxing such rules
Noise Mitigation: A Critical Factor for SeaTac ADU Construction
One of the most distinctive challenges for ADU contractors in SeaTac is addressing aircraft noise. The city falls within the Airport Influence Area, and many properties are subject to significant noise levels measured in Day-Night Average Sound Levels (DNL). Contractors must often incorporate sound attenuation measures such as enhanced insulation, double-pane or triple-pane windows, and specialized ventilation systems to meet habitability standards. Some properties may even qualify for the Port of Seattle's Residential Sound Insulation Program, which can offset certain construction costs.
Why Hire a Local SeaTac ADU Contractor?
Working with an ADU contractor who has direct experience in SeaTac provides significant advantages. A knowledgeable local contractor will be familiar with:
- Permit submission processes through the SeaTac Community and Economic Development Department
- Coordination with King County utilities and infrastructure requirements
- FAA Part 77 airspace obstruction standards that may limit building height
- Local inspection timelines and building department expectations
Maximizing Your Investment with an ADU in SeaTac
Despite its unique regulatory environment, SeaTac presents a strong opportunity for ADU development. The city's location along the Link Light Rail corridor and its proximity to major employment hubs make rental ADUs highly attractive.
